Since most of nonclassical properties are susceptible to noise in quantum channels and imperfections of measurement devices, development of techniques overcoming these difficulties is critically important. Based on results already discussed in literature and on our preliminary considerations, we conclude that there exists a group of nonclassical correlations, which possess the needed property of stability with high degree of certainty. The main objectives of this project consist in building a systematic theory of such correlations and in utilizing them for improvement of quantum communication protocols. Particularly, the following objectives are expected to be achieved: (i) Formulation of an appropriate form for description and characterization of nonclassical correlations, which depend on the available information about measurement devices; (ii) Implementation of factors, which hinder distinguishing between adjacent photon numbers, into the photodetection theory; (iii) Consistent description of long-distance free-space channels and time-domain sub-channels; (iv) Application of the obtained results for formulation of innovative quantum-communication protocols. popup.nrat_date 2024-12-10 Close
